- Definition of Faith: the substance of things hoped for
- Definition of Fear: faith in things that we do not hope for
I’ve also heard the definitions of faith and fear expressed as thus:
- Definition of Faith: Belief in the promises of God
- Definition of Fear: Belief in the promises of the devil (won’t give him the satisfaction of a capitalization ; )
We run up against these two each day. How do we latch on to the promises of God, while combatting the promises of Satan?
- Remember that Satan has no actual power over us that we do not give to him.
- Read God’s word - The Bible is how we know what God’s promises are. I recommend trying to read every day, even if only for a few minutes. I’m struggle with this one, but have seen extraordinary value in the short bursts of time where I have maintained this comittment (like the previous series…)
- Corporate worship - Obviously we should go to church. This is not because it is “the right thing to do”, but rather because God put us together to operate as a cohesive unit - the “body of Christ”. Also, find a ’small group’ of believers with which you may grow together.
- Get God’s word coming in at other angles - The Internet is a great place to find God’s word. I actually believe that was the primary reason God gave us the idea.
